Waterworks is a hybrid, mixed-use space that conserves and expands an industrial heritage site through the integration of diverse programs – not only supporting the life of its residents, but the greater community. The design combines food-focused retail, a fully serviced YMCA with extensive social facilities, a mid-rise condominium with family-oriented dwellings, and an existing youth shelter. Situated at the northern edge of Toronto’s oldest public playground, the scheme is defined by a 1932 Art Deco City of Toronto Waterworks building which spans a city block.
